Lavaur
Tarn · France
A compact town in the Tarn department of southern France's Occitanie region, Lavaur sits on the Agout river and has a central core with cafés and restaurants. Historically part of the Lauragais — once called the "Pays de Cocagne" for its woad cultivation and agricultural abundance — it lies within reach of several UNESCO World Heritage sites in the wider region.
